VISHNU
Vishnu maintains dharma by incarnating as characters such as Ram and Krishna in order to defeat evil and restore balance. He embodies compassion, generosity, and stability. He represents ultimate reality and ensures the world's continuity. He is often shown with the discus, conch, club, and lotus while resting on the serpent Shesha or riding his vahana, Garuda, the eagle. Vishnu is also closely associated with his divine consort, Lakshmi, the goddess of prosperity, abundance, and good fortune. Together they symbolize the harmonious union of preservation and nourishment that sustains both the cosmos and human life.
